What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Perth to Taipei City?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Perth to Taipei City Taiwan Taoyuan Intl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Perth to Taipei City, Monday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Sunday is the most expensive. Flying from Taipei City back to Perth, the best deals are generally found on Friday, with Sunday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Perth to Taipei City Taiwan Taoyuan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Perth to Taipei City Taiwan Taoyuan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Perth to Taipei City Taiwan Taoyuan Intl Airport is August, where tickets cost $442 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and January,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,286 and $1,063 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Perth to Taipei City Taiwan Taoyuan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Perth to Taipei City Taiwan Taoyuan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Perth to Taipei City Taiwan Taoyuan Intl Airport,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 21%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 3 weeks before departure.

Scoot is a no frills budget airline. Do not expect a legacy airline experience.

I have taken more than 50 flights in the past year and this is the worst onboard experience that I've come across. There's always a risk with budget airlines and their creative views of customer service. Having bought a standard seat, we boarded at the assigned seat - we naturally couldn't choose ourselves as that would be extra cost. After take-off, the person in the row in front leans back their seat. As a frequent flyer, I believe this is their right, so I try to lean my seat back as well to have the same space available. However, my standard seat could not lean back, as the row behind was an exit row. As I had paid for a standard seat, not a less space than standard, I moved to the completely free row behind me. This was not allowed, as due to extra legroom, this would cost extra. Subsequently spent the next 30 mins discussing this scenario with the crew. I have no issues with budget airlines and additional charges, but if I pay for a standard seat, I want a standard seat, not one with less space. As you do not offer me a discount for the less space, do not try and charge me a premium, when I find a free seat with more space. It works both ways Scoot.
